Couple of things off the top of my head:
1. Check the size of your listener.log file. Resize it to 0 by issuing the
following command at the Unix prompt:
# >listener.log
2. You're running some type NIS, DNS, etc that is unable to connect to the database initially and must manually locate the server. Hey, I know I don't make sense, I haven't had my coffee yet. ;)
